Worth knowing

Chimney sweep logs do not sweep chimneys. They loosen some creosote - which then falls where a brush and vacuum still have to collect it.

Our Chimney Liner & Rebuild Services in Ashford

Stainless Steel Liner

A rigid stainless liner is the standard fix for Ashford’s unlined masonry flues. In homes built before 1900 around Warrenville or along Route 44, the original flue was meant for open-hearth fires, where heat escaped freely and creosote didn’t condense the way it does with today’s sealed stoves and inserts. A properly sized stainless liner narrows the flue, holds heat, and gives creosote far less to cling to. We use rigid DuraFlex liners in most cases because they withstand freeze-thaw cycling better than thin knockoffs.

Flexible Liner

When the existing flue isn’t perfectly plumb, or when an Ashford homeowner only needs a liner for a single wood stove connection, a flexible liner handles the offsets without cutting into the house. We install UL-listed flexible systems from brands we trust, including Olympia Chimney and Famco. For exposed chimneys on the north side of an Ashford ridge, where wind-driven freeze-thaw hits hardest, we may recommend rigid over flex. We’ll show you why on the camera.

Liner Replacement

Homes that had wood stoves retrofitted in the 1970s energy-crisis era often have liners that are now undersized, corroded, or improperly flashed at the top. We see this constantly in Ashford’s older ranch homes and rural cottages. If your liner is cracked, pitted, or leaking flue gas into the chimney chase, replacement is not an upsell. Partial Rebuild

An Ashford chimney that’s spalling badly above the roofline often doesn’t need a full teardown. We frequently rebuild just the top four to eight courses, replace the crown with a proper poured concrete cap, and install a new flashing. In our experience, the freeze-thaw cycling at Ashford’s inland elevation hits the exposed top section hardest while the lower stack is still solid. A partial rebuild addresses the failure without charging you for work the chimney doesn’t need.

Full Chimney Rebuild

When the structural damage runs deep, from the top of the stack down through the smoke chamber, a full rebuild is the honest answer. We see this most often on Ashford farmhouses where decades of water intrusion have rotted the mortar from the inside out. A full rebuild means taking the chimney down and relaying it with properly mixed mortar, a correctly sized liner, and a crown that actually sheds water. Common Chimney Liner & Rebuild Problems We See in Ashford Homes

  • Unlined flues in pre-1900 farmhouses. These wide, cold stacks condense creosote fast. First-degree creosote turns to tar glaze inside a single burn season, especially when the firewood was cut the same year and never properly seasoned.
  • Freeze-thaw crown and mortar failure. Ashford’s inland elevation means harder winters and more freeze-thaw cycles than coastal Connecticut. Exposed crowns crack, water gets in, and the brick starts spalling behind the liner.
  • Undersized 1970s wood stove flues. A lot of Ashford homes had stoves retrofitted during the energy crisis. The connections were often undersized or flashed wrong, which causes backdrafting and smoke damage that looks like a dirty chimney but isn’t.
  • Sluggish draft from oversized flues. Colonial-era flues were built for open hearths, not sealed appliances. An oversized flue stays cold, smoke lingers, and creosote builds up faster than any brush can keep up with.

Pricing for Chimney Liner & Rebuild in Ashford, CT

A stainless steel liner installation in Ashford typically runs $2,800-$4,500 for a standard one-story run, and $4,000-$6,500 when the flue is taller, offset, or needs a chimney cover and new cap. Partial rebuilds usually land between $2,500 and $5,000, depending on how many courses need relaying. Full chimney rebuilds in Ashford start around $6,000 and can reach $12,000 or more for a large farmhouse stack with extensive spalling. The variables are flue height, access, liner diameter, and how much of the masonry is salvageable. We quote the full price before work begins, and the estimate is free.
